Handover: bulk edits in the Orchid admin table now go through the staged-apply flow. Select rows, hit Apply Draft, and changes queue for a dry run before commit. Don't use the legacy inline editor — it skips validation and broke tags twice last quarter. Rollback is one click within 24 hours. Questions about the staged-apply flow go to the engineer below.

named custodian: Brivan Eliath Quenox Frador

Welcome to the Loompress team. Our template renderer compiles each layout once and caches the bytecode; most performance issues trace back to cache misses, not the compiler itself. Before changing anything, read the profiling chapter of the internal handbook and run the benchmark suite against the Harrowfield staging cluster. Baseline numbers live in the perf dashboard, and regressions over 10% require sign-off. If anything in the benchmarks looks off during your first weeks, ask the performance guild at the address below.

pager mailbox: silael.sorwyn.tamius@zemvarsys.corp

## Service Accounts: Payroll Export Pipeline

Reviewers checking changes to the Fernhollow payroll exporter should note the format migration from fixed-width to the new columnar schema in release 7.1. The export job runs under a dedicated service account scoped to the payroll bucket only; it cannot read employee records directly. Any diff touching the serializer must keep backward-compatible headers for two cycles. To run the export integration suite locally, authenticate with the service account key that follows.

gateway credential: qvz15-xHvBwSz5Z4mBMZC

## v4.7.2 — Sort stability fix

The Lumenquill report builder previously used an unstable sort when grouping rows by category, causing ties to reorder nondeterministically between renders. We now apply a stable merge sort with the original row index as the final tiebreaker. Snapshot tests in `reports/sorting_spec` cover the tie cases. Future maintainers: do not swap this back to the native comparator. Questions go to the engineer named below.

account owner for tawef-yadug: Jorius Normir Silath